From: Shawn O. Pearce Date: Sun, 19 Nov 2006 08:46:29 +0000 (-0500) Subject: git-gui: Correct some state matchings for include/remove. X-Git-Tag: gitgui-0.6.0~178 X-Git-Url: http://git.tremily.us/?a=commitdiff_plain;h=375f38828e9c50ad79b6582e768db410216c2c41;p=git.git git-gui: Correct some state matchings for include/remove. Signed-off-by: Shawn O. Pearce --- diff --git a/git-gui b/git-gui index dcb25c8d6..dcbb100fe 100755 --- a/git-gui +++ b/git-gui @@ -1676,6 +1676,7 @@ foreach i { {DO i removed "Removed (still exists)"} {DM i removed "Removed (but modified)"} + {UD i merge "Merge conflicts"} {UM i merge "Merge conflicts"} {U_ i merge "Merge conflicts"} } { @@ -2033,12 +2034,11 @@ proc include_helper {txt paths} { set pathList [list] set after {} foreach path $paths { - switch -- [lindex $file_states($path) 0] { + switch -glob -- [lindex $file_states($path) 0] { AM - AD - MM - - UM - - U_ - + U? - _M - _D - _O { @@ -2437,7 +2437,8 @@ proc toggle_or_diff {w x y} { A_ - M_ - DD - - D_ { + DO - + DM { update_indexinfo \ "Removing [short_path $path] from commit" \ [list $path] \